Wheelwright Name Meaning

English (Yorkshire): occupational name from Middle English whelewright(e) whelrihte ‘wheelwright maker of wheels and wheeled vehicles’ (Old English hwēol + wyrhta). See also Wheeler .

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Wheelwright family from?

You can see how Wheelwright families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Wheelwright family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1840 and 1920. The most Wheelwright families were found in United Kingdom in 1891. In 1891 there were 199 Wheelwright families living in Yorkshire. This was about 44% of all the recorded Wheelwright's in United Kingdom. Yorkshire had the highest population of Wheelwright families in 1891.

What did your Wheelwright ancestors do for a living?

In 1939, Cotton Weaver and Unpaid Domestic Duties were the top reported jobs for men and women in the United Kingdom named Wheelwright. 12% of Wheelwright men worked as a Cotton Weaver and 80% of Wheelwright women worked as an Unpaid Domestic Duties.
